Make the user find the truth themselves. | **Jesus** is the moral thread throughout: parables as reasoning tools, uncomfortable truth, intellectual accountability. ## Unique Training Data 2.1B tokens, 100% open-licensed. No web crawl. Every token teaches reasoning: - **1,240+ classical texts** from Project Gutenberg (Plato to Darwin to Jung) - **Supreme Court opinions** (structured judicial reasoning) - **Oxford-style debate transcripts** (adversarial argumentation) - **D&D transcripts** (collaborative reasoning under uncertainty) - **Repair guides** (diagnostic logic: symptom → cause → fix) - **Formal proofs** (Lean, Coq, Isabelle) - **44K+ SFT examples** with Socratic dialogues, tool use, and sycophancy resistance ## Specs | | | |---|---| | Parameters | 1.1B (d36, 2304 dim, 18 heads, 3 KV heads) | | Context | 64K native, 128K best-effort | | Memory (Q4 + 128K) | 2.3 GB (fits on phone) | | Architecture | GQA 6:1, Sliding Window, FA3, Smear+Backout, MuonAdamW | | Training | 2x H200 SXM, 6 epochs, ~$153 | | Post-training | SAGE-GRPO + PRM + PoSE context extension | ## Anti-Sycophantic by Design Most models agree with you.
